<blockquote data-quote="shortgrass" data-source="post: 2696200" data-attributes="member: 24284"><p>We need to know, to the thousandth, how much set-back there is to give any reasonable answer to your question. Hopefully, you have a snug to tight fitting mandrel that you can run between centers with the action mounted on it to square the face of the front ring. Accurate measurement with a depth mic from there.</p></blockquote><p></p>
